SKAN Group AG (SWX:SKAN)
Switzerland flag Switzerland · Delayed Price · Currency is CHF
73.40
+0.80 (1.10%)
Jul 16, 2025, 5:30 PM CET

SKAN Group AG Ratios and Metrics

Millions CHF.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Jul '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
1,6321,7131,8171,4161,992157
Upgrade
Market Cap Growth
-5.69%-5.69%28.25%-28.89%1168.29%63.93%
Upgrade
Enterprise Value
1,5881,6771,7331,3501,973152
Upgrade
Last Close Price
72.6075.7579.9862.1887.0913.88
Upgrade
PE Ratio
42.0744.1569.0474.61187.6534.66
Upgrade
Forward PE
36.2140.1647.0250.60--
Upgrade
PS Ratio
4.524.745.685.118.500.82
Upgrade
PB Ratio
8.068.4610.308.5511.451.90
Upgrade
P/TBV Ratio
8.418.8310.859.1212.603.94
Upgrade
P/FCF Ratio
---40.07-15.97
Upgrade
P/OCF Ratio
34.9536.69208.8123.04193.086.94
Upgrade
PEG Ratio
1.500.950.950.86--
Upgrade
EV/Sales Ratio
4.394.645.424.878.420.79
Upgrade
EV/EBITDA Ratio
29.0630.6936.1235.2967.469.08
Upgrade
EV/EBIT Ratio
35.6937.7045.9045.8285.5812.65
Upgrade
EV/FCF Ratio
-366.99--38.18-15.47
Upgrade
Debt / Equity Ratio
0.050.050.040.100.090.09
Upgrade
Debt / EBITDA Ratio
0.190.190.140.440.520.44
Upgrade
Debt / FCF Ratio
---0.48-0.76
Upgrade
Asset Turnover
0.950.950.840.770.791.03
Upgrade
Inventory Turnover
0.870.870.760.900.91-
Upgrade
Quick Ratio
0.630.630.680.871.200.57
Upgrade
Current Ratio
1.371.371.431.491.871.22
Upgrade
Return on Equity (ROE)
21.53%21.53%16.32%12.63%16.68%11.92%
Upgrade
Return on Assets (ROA)
7.34%7.34%6.19%5.11%4.87%4.04%
Upgrade
Return on Capital (ROIC)
14.04%14.04%12.92%9.91%10.32%7.45%
Upgrade
Return on Capital Employed (ROCE)
20.10%20.10%19.60%15.40%11.80%12.50%
Upgrade
Earnings Yield
2.38%2.27%1.45%1.34%0.53%2.89%
Upgrade
FCF Yield
-0.27%-0.25%-1.37%2.50%-1.44%6.26%
Upgrade
Dividend Yield
0.28%0.53%0.44%0.40%0.28%15.13%
Upgrade
Payout Ratio
20.28%20.28%21.36%28.42%100.01%-
Upgrade
Buyback Yield / Dilution
----77.83%-20.74%-0.03%
Upgrade
Total Shareholder Return
0.28%0.53%0.44%-77.42%-20.47%15.10%
Upgrade
Updated Aug 19, 2024. Source: S&P Global Market Intelligence. Standard template. Financial Sources.